The Saints Peter and Paul Church (Kościół Świętych Apostołów Piotra i Pawła) is a prominent neo-Gothic Roman Catholic church located in the village of Kraszewice, within Ostrzeszów County, Greater Poland Voivodeship, in west-central Poland. Standing at an elevation of approximately 169 meters above sea level, this impressive religious building serves as a significant historical site and a local landmark. Its distinctive architecture makes it one of the notable Kraszewice Poland local attractions.

    The neo-Gothic church of Saints Peter and Paul was built in the years 1882-1888 according to the design of the architect Józef Chrzanowski on the site of a previous, wooden church erected in 1787. It was consecrated on May 10, 1909.

    What is the architectural style of Saints Peter and Paul Church?

    The Saints Peter and Paul Church is a significant example of neo-Gothic sacral architecture from the late 19th century. Its design features a striking brick structure, a tall tower, three naves, and intricate details that give it a "cathedral-like" impression.

    When was the current church building constructed?

    The current neo-Gothic church was constructed between 1882 and 1888. It was built on the site of an earlier wooden church from 1787 and was consecrated on May 10, 1909.

    Are there any specific historical artifacts or features inside the church?

    Yes, the church's interior features beautiful vaulting and pillars, creating a vast space. It also houses a Baroque-Classicist side altar, which was moved from the previous church that stood on this site.

    What other local attractions or landmarks are there to see in Kraszewice?

    Beyond the Saints Peter and Paul Church, Kraszewice is a historic village first mentioned in the 13th century. In 1918, residents planted an "Oak of Freedom" next to the church to commemorate Poland's regained independence, which is another point of interest. The village's historical context and rural setting offer a glimpse into local Polish heritage.
